Head’s Up A head’s up drag race is a winner-take-all race where both cars leave the starting line simultaneously, rather than using a dial-in or handicap. HOLDING UP TRAFFIC When a slower race car causes cars running faster on the track to slow and does not heed the "move over flag" of the race officials. Build sheet.Document generated at the assembly plant showing workers what specific components to install on each car as it went down the assembly line. Fuel Injection System: Injects fuel into the engine’s cylinders with electronic control to time and meter the fuel flow.
